England vs Sri Lanka Head To Head Records & Stats

In the 78 One Day International (ODI) matches between England and Sri Lanka, England emerged victorious in 38 games, while Sri Lanka won 36 times. Three matches concluded without a result, and one match ended in a tie.

Here’s a table summarizing the ODI head to head matches between England and Sri Lanka:

OutcomeNumber of Matches
England Wins38
Sri Lanka Wins36
No Result3
Tied1

England vs Sri Lanka Head To Head Records & Stats ODI World Cup

In the ICC ODI World Cup tournaments, England and Sri Lanka have played against each other in 11 matches. Among these, England has won 6 games, while Sri Lanka has emerged victorious on 5 occasions. The highest total scored by England in these encounters is 333 runs, while Sri Lanka’s highest score is 312. On the flip side, Sri Lanka’s lowest total is 136, and England’s lowest is 137 in the prestigious World Cup matches.

Here’s a table summarizing the head to head for ICC ODI World Cup matches between England and Sri Lanka:

OutcomeNumber of Matches
England Wins6
Sri Lanka Wins5
Highest England Score333 runs
Highest Sri Lanka Score312 runs
Lowest England Score137 runs
Lowest Sri Lanka Score136 runs
